Runbook: Account Recovery — Parcelwire Webhook

If the Parcelwire webhook signing account is lost: disable inbound delivery first. Rotate the HMAC secret from the Droxel console. Re-register the endpoint; backlog replays automatically after 10 minutes. Recovery of the signing account requires the sealed credentials in the ops locker. To open the locker, the unseal tool prompts for the recovery passphrase, entered exactly as shown below.

unlock words, hahip-baduf: holwyn-istath-julvan

If you're new to the Brightpath reminder job: this worker scans tomorrow's appointments at the Fernvale clinics and queues SMS and email nudges. The batch size and retry backoff matter more than they look — too aggressive and we hammer the gateway during the morning spike, too gentle and reminders land after the visit. The values below were tuned against last quarter's traffic, so change them with care. The current tuning constants are:

tuning table, yajog-yahof:
BUDGETS = {
    "lamvan": 303,
    "wenox": 460,
    "fenvan": 525,
}

14:32 — Render latency on Fernwick templates climbed past the alert threshold. Investigation showed the partial-cache was being invalidated on every request due to a timestamp comparison bug introduced that morning. Latency returned to baseline after the cache key fix was deployed. The fix first appeared in the build below.

build token for yajof-bajof: htk31_506ff1188f74596b5bb2eec94edc43c